Position Summary
The Etch & Plasma Area Equipment Engineering Manager is a highly technical semiconductor equipment leadership role responsible for driving equipment reliability, process stability, and operational excellence across plasma and dry etch manufacturing operations. This role supports advanced semiconductor fabrication processes tied to cutting-edge photonics, AI, and optoelectronic technologies.
While this role carries a management title, the primary focus is deep technical expertise and hands-on equipment engineering leadership. The ideal candidate will have strong experience with plasma and dry etch semiconductor equipment and the ability to lead troubleshooting, process improvements, and tool performance initiatives within a fast-paced fab environment. Candidates with senior principal-level technical expertise but limited formal management experience are also strongly considered.
This position plays a critical role in building scalable operational processes, improving equipment uptime, and supporting the expansion of advanced semiconductor manufacturing operations.
What You’ll Do
- Lead equipment engineering efforts supporting plasma and dry etch semiconductor manufacturing tools
- Drive equipment uptime, reliability improvements, and process stability initiatives across multiple toolsets including Ash, PVD, and PECVD platforms
- Partner closely with engineers and technicians to troubleshoot and resolve complex equipment issues
- Develop metrics, KPIs, and performance goals tied to tool availability, MTBF, PM compliance, and operational efficiency
- Lead daily operational reviews, issue escalation discussions, and recovery planning activities
- Establish structured preventive maintenance strategies and reliability improvement programs
- Drive corrective and preventive actions using structured problem-solving methodologies including 5Y, 8D, and FMEA
- Support process transfers, equipment installations, and manufacturing scale-up activities
- Collaborate cross-functionally with Process Engineering, Operations, Facilities, EHS, and Manufacturing leadership teams
- Evaluate opportunities for tool upgrades, automation improvements, and cost reduction initiatives
- Support capital equipment projects, vendor coordination, and installation activities
- Utilize SPC, MES, CMMS, and manufacturing data systems to improve data-driven decision-making
- Mentor and support engineers and technicians through hands-on leadership and technical guidance
- Maintain accurate maintenance records, PM documentation, and equipment history logs
